Carrabba's Italian Grill Store locator Pennsylvania

Carrabba's Italian Grill stores located in Pennsylvania: 2
Largest shopping mall with Carrabba's Italian Grill store in Pennsylvania: Palmer Park Mall 

Carrabba's Italian Grill store locator Pennsylvania displays complete list and huge database of Carrabba's Italian Grill stores, factory stores, shops and boutiques in Pennsylvania. Carrabba's Italian Grill information: map of Pennsylvania, shopping hours, contact information.

Search all Carrabba's Italian Grill stores located in Pennsylvania

Specify Carrabba's Italian Grill store location:

Go to the city Carrabba's Italian Grill locator